dc.descriptionTchakaloff's Theorem establishes the existence of a quadrature rule of prescribed degree relative to a positive, compactly supported measure that is absolutely continuous with respect to Lebesgue measure on $\mathbb{R}^{d}$. Subsequent extensions were obtained by Mysovskikh and by Putinar. We provide new proofs and partial extensions of these results, based on duality techniques utilized by Stochel. We also obtain new uniqueness criteria in the Truncated Complex Moment Problem.
